Viacom Walks Away From DirectTV Negotiations

According to Variety, Viacom has walked away from negotiations with DirectTV. This means that Spike TV, Comedy Central, MTV and other Viacom properties will remain off air on DirectTV systems. DirecTV claims Viacom tried to add a last-minute item during negotiations while Viacom claims DirecTV has balked at revised proposals.

Of note to wrestling fans, Spike TV has been down 14 percent in viewership during negotiations (358,000 vs. 417,000 in daily viewership). This matches the drop-off for last week’s TNA iMPACT!.
